Technological Disruption & Innovation in South Korea Prosthetic Connector Market Innovation is at the core of South Korea’s prosthetic connector evolution, with disruptive technologies transforming patient outcomes. Osseointegration, which involves direct skeletal attachment, is revolutionizing prosthetic stability and comfort, reducing skin-related issues associated with traditional socket-based systems. Smart connectors embedded with sensors enable real-time monitoring of load and fit, enhancing personalization and maintenance. 3D printing and additive manufacturing are enabling rapid prototyping and customized solutions, reducing lead times and costs. Advances in biomaterials, such as titanium alloys and bioactive composites, improve biocompatibility and longevity. Furthermore, integration with digital health platforms allows remote diagnostics and adaptive adjustments, creating a new paradigm of connected prosthetic care. These innovations are fostering a competitive edge for early adopters and creating new standards for prosthetic performance and patient satisfaction. Regulatory Framework & Policy Impact on South Korea Prosthetic Connector Market The South Korean regulatory environment for medical devices, including prosthetic connectors, is governed by the Ministry of Food and Drug Safety (MFDS). Stringent approval processes and compliance standards ensure safety and efficacy but can pose barriers to rapid market entry. Recent reforms aim to streamline approval pathways for innovative devices, encouraging local R&D and commercialization. Government incentives and subsidies for medical device startups bolster innovation, while policies promoting digital health integration facilitate the adoption of smart connectors. However, evolving standards require continuous compliance efforts, impacting time-to-market and costs. Trade policies and import tariffs also influence the competitive landscape, especially for international players. Overall, a proactive regulatory approach combined with supportive policies is essential for market growth and technological advancement in South Korea.
